China locks down Lanzhou city which has 39 cases in current outbreak
#1

China placed a city of four million people under lockdown yesterday, ordering them not to leave home except in emergencies, in a bid to eradicate a Covid-19 cluster of just a few dozen confirmed cases.

Yesterday's fresh restrictions came as China reported 29 new domestic infections - including six in Lanzhou, the capital of Gansu province in the country's north-west.

The latest outbreak has been linked to the highly contagious Delta variant, with the tally hitting 198 cases since Oct 17.

Thirty-nine have been in Lanzhou.
